Mastering the Future: Essential Skills, Best Practices, and Career Opportunities in Smart Contracts and DAOs

November 26, 2025 3 min read James Kumar

Discover essential skills, best practices, and career opportunities in smart contracts and DAOs with our comprehensive Postgraduate Certificate program and excel in blockchain technology.

In the rapidly evolving landscape of blockchain technology, a Postgraduate Certificate in Smart Contracts and Decentralized Autonomous Organizations (DAOs) stands out as a beacon for those looking to dive deep into the intricacies of decentralized systems. This comprehensive program equips students with the essential skills and best practices needed to navigate the complex world of smart contracts and DAOs, setting them up for a successful career in this burgeoning field.

# Essential Skills for Smart Contracts and DAO Professionals

To excel in the realm of smart contracts and DAOs, professionals need a diverse set of skills that go beyond technical proficiency. Here are some of the key competencies you should focus on:

1. Programming Expertise: Proficiency in languages like Solidity (the primary language for Ethereum smart contracts) is crucial. Understanding the syntax and best practices in Solidity can help you write secure and efficient contracts.

2. Cryptography and Security: A solid grasp of cryptographic principles is essential for ensuring the security of smart contracts. Knowledge of common vulnerabilities and how to mitigate them can save you from costly errors.

3. Blockchain Fundamentals: A strong foundation in blockchain technology, including consensus algorithms, distributed ledgers, and decentralized networks, is vital. This understanding will help you design and implement robust smart contracts and DAOs.

4. Legal and Regulatory Knowledge: Navigating the legal and regulatory landscape is crucial. Understanding the legal implications of smart contracts and DAOs can help you avoid compliance issues and ensure that your projects are legally sound.

5. Project Management: Effective project management skills are essential for overseeing the development and deployment of smart contracts and DAOs. This includes planning, execution, and monitoring to ensure project success.

# Best Practices for Smart Contract Development

Developing smart contracts requires adhering to best practices to ensure security, efficiency, and scalability. Here are some practical insights:

1. Code Audits: Regular code audits are essential to identify and fix vulnerabilities. Engage with third-party auditors to provide an unbiased review of your smart contracts.

2. Gas Optimization: Writing gas-efficient code is critical for reducing transaction costs. Optimize your smart contracts to minimize gas usage without compromising functionality.

3. Modular Design: Use a modular approach to design your smart contracts. Breaking down complex contracts into smaller, manageable modules makes the code easier to understand, test, and maintain.

4. Documentation: Thorough documentation is key. Documenting your code, including comments and external documents, helps other developers understand your contracts and ensures smoother collaboration.

5. Testing and Simulation: Rigorous testing and simulation are crucial. Use tools like Truffle, Hardhat, or Remix to test your smart contracts in various scenarios before deployment.

# Career Opportunities in Smart Contracts and DAOs

The demand for professionals skilled in smart contracts and DAOs is on the rise. Here are some career paths you can explore:

1. Smart Contract Developer: As a smart contract developer, you will design, write, and deploy smart contracts. This role requires strong programming skills and a deep understanding of blockchain technology.

2. Blockchain Architect: Blockchain architects design the overall architecture of blockchain systems, including smart contracts and DAOs. This role involves high-level strategic planning and technical expertise.

3. DAO Governance Specialist: Specialists in DAO governance focus on the legal, regulatory, and operational aspects of decentralized autonomous organizations. They ensure that DAOs operate efficiently and comply with relevant laws.

4. Blockchain Security Expert: Security experts in the blockchain space focus on identifying and mitigating vulnerabilities in smart contracts and DAOs. This role is crucial for ensuring the security of decentralized systems.

5. Consultant: As

Ready to Transform Your Career?

Take the next step in your professional journey with our comprehensive course designed for business leaders

Disclaimer

The views and opinions expressed in this blog are those of the individual authors and do not necessarily reflect the official policy or position of LSBR London - Executive Education. The content is created for educational purposes by professionals and students as part of their continuous learning journey. LSBR London - Executive Education does not guarantee the accuracy, completeness, or reliability of the information presented. Any action you take based on the information in this blog is strictly at your own risk. LSBR London - Executive Education and its affiliates will not be liable for any losses or damages in connection with the use of this blog content.

5,134 views
Back to Blog

This course help you to:

  • Boost your Salary
  • Increase your Professional Reputation, and
  • Expand your Networking Opportunities

Ready to take the next step?

Enrol now in the

Postgraduate Certificate in Smart Contracts and Decentralized Autonomous Organizations

Enrol Now